What happens if you take more than 100% daily vitamin c everyday?

Usually not: Vitamin c is water soluble vitamin and excess is excreted through kidneys.Usually no ill effect as seen in overdoses of fat soluble vitamins such as vitamins a, d, e.These are not easily excreted from body when overdosed.Although too much dietary vitamin c is unlikely to be harmful, megadoses of c may cause diarrhea, nausea, vomiting, heartburn, abdominal bloating, insomnia, kidney stones, headache.
